Top 5 Educational Games Apps in Austria Q3 2021
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 educational games apps in Austria during Q3 2021, including we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the third quarter of 2021, the top 5 educational games apps in Austria showed varied performance trends across we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at each app’s performance based on data from Sensor Tower.
Masha and the Bear Educational from DTC Lab saw its weekly revenue peak at $15 in the week of July 26, with fluctuations throughout the quarter. Weekly downloads reached a high of 477 in the last week of September, while weekly active users increased from 1.6K to a peak of 2K in mid-September, ending the quarter at 1.8K.
Baby phone: games for kids 1-5 by Bimi Boo Kids Learning Games for Toddlers FZ-LLC experienced a notable spike in weekly downloads, peaking at 948 in the last week of August. Weekly revenue showed variability, reaching up to $105 in mid-September. The app's weekly active users peaked at 2K in late August before stabilizing around 1.2K by the end of the quarter.
Lingokids - Play and Learn, published by Lingokids - English Learning For Kids, exhibited a strong performance in terms of revenue, peaking at $873 in the last week of August. Weekly downloads fluctuated, reaching a high of 444 at the end of September. Active users increased steadily, peaking at 729 in the final week of the quarter.
Montessori Preschool, kids 3-7 from EDOKI ACADEMY showed a steady increase in weekly revenue, peaking at $789 in the last week of September. Weekly downloads remained relatively stable, with a peak of 286 in mid-September. Active users also showed consistent growth, reaching 574 by the end of the quarter.
Math Kids: Math Games For Kids by RV AppStudios did not generate revenue during this period. However, weekly downloads saw an upward trend, peaking at 374 in the last week of September. Active users similarly increased, reaching a high of 427 in the final week of the quarter.
